How Doppler Radar Technology Powers Weather Intelligence The fundamental principle behind Doppler radar involves emitting microwave pulses into the atmosphere and analyzing the frequency shift of the returned signals. Unlike older radar systems that only showed precipitation location, Doppler provides crucial velocity data, revealing rotational patterns that indicate tornado development or intense downbursts capable of causing significant damage in populated areas like Bonita Springs.
